Lamar University is in Beaumont, TX.

For the most recent IPEDS reporting year, 271 information science degrees were awarded at Lamar University.

Studying Online at Lamar University

Distance learning is available at Lamar University. Among 17,772 students, 10,722 (60%) studied exclusively online and 4,507 (25%) took at least some classes online.

Information Science Master’s Program at Lamar University

Of the 271 master’s information science degrees awarded at Lamar University, 43% were women (117) and 57% were men (154).

The following table and chart show the race/ethnicity of Information Science master’s degree recipients at Lamar University.

Race / Ethnicity Number of Graduates
White 37
Hispanic / Latino 17
Black / African American 37
Asian 13
Two or More Races 1
International (Nonresident) 165
Unknown 1
Racial-ethnic diversity of Information Science majors at Lamar University

Minority students account for 25% of Information Science master’s degree recipients at Lamar University, higher than the national average of 20%.*

*The racial-ethnic minorities figure is the total number of graduates minus White, international (nonresident), and unknown-race graduates.
